What is a Network Digital Twin?

A Network Digital Twin is a virtual replica of a network’s infrastructure, encompassing switches, routers, firewalls, campus networks, data centers, and WAN environments.

This dynamic simulation allows organizations to mirror their entire network, offering unparalleled insights and testing capabilities without impacting live environments.

 

Why is a Network Digital Twin Useful?

1. Enhanced Testing and Validation

Before deploying changes in a live environment, organizations can test configurations, updates, and security within the digital twin, reducing the risk of downtime and service disruptions.

2. Security and Compliance Assurance

By simulating potential cyber threats, IT teams can proactively identify vulnerabilities and fine-tune security protocols.

3. Performance Optimization

Organizations can analyze network behavior under various conditions, optimizing traffic flow, reducing bottlenecks, and improving overall efficiency.

4. Accelerated Troubleshooting

With a fully functional replica of the network, IT teams can quickly diagnose issues, replicate problems, and implement fixes faster than traditional troubleshooting methods.

5. Training and Skill Development

A digital twin provides a sandbox environment for IT teams to experiment and develop expertise without the risk of affecting production networks.

 

Who Would Use a Network Digital Twin?

Network Digital Twins are beneficial for a wide range of professionals and industries, including:

Network Engineers – For testing new configurations and optimizing performance.

Security Teams – For conducting penetration tests and enhancing threat detection.

IT Operations – For minimizing downtime by proactively identifying and resolving issues.

Cloud and DevOps Teams– For integrating and ensuring smooth cloud transitions.

Educational Institutions – For training future network professionals in a real-world simulation environment.
